摘 要:【目的】白细胞介素-18通过激活Th1细胞和NK细胞产生IFN-γ而发挥关键的免疫调节作用。人和小鼠分泌的白细胞介素-18结合蛋白(IL-18BP)可以拮抗其活性。推测在鸡痘病毒基因组中也含有IL-18BP基因的同源物,对其表达的蛋白质进行了活性鉴定,为拮抗IL-18主导的疾病提供理论依据。【方法】根据鸡痘疫苗病毒的基因组序列设计特异性引物,使用PCR方法从中分离cIL-18BP基因,将该基因克隆到酵母表达载体pPICZαA中,甲醇诱导后在酵母GS115中进行表达。对表达的重组蛋白进行了活性鉴定。【结果】从鸡痘病毒中克隆到cIL-18BP基因,SDS-PAGE鉴定了该基因在酵母系统中的高效表达。ELISA检测表明纯化后的cIL-18BP与重组鸡(c)IL-18发生特异性结合;通过测定IFN-γ的浓度,表明该蛋白具有拮抗IL-18刺激外周血单核细胞(PBMCs)和MSB1细胞分泌IFN-γ的活性。【结论】实验表明,cIL-18BP通过抑制cIL-18刺激相关免疫细胞分泌IFN-γ而发挥对IL-18的拮抗作用,敲除该基因可能有助于研制更安全和高效的鸡痘疫苗。Objective Interleukin-18(IL-18) is a proinflammatory cytokines that plays a key role of immune regulation through activating the Th 1 cell and NK cell secreting interferon-γ(IFN-γ).IL-18-binding proteins(IL-18BP) secreted in human and mouse can antagonise the activity of IL-18.The homologue gene of IL-18BP from fowlpox virus genome was predicted and identified of its expressed protein,to use as an antagonist to IL-18 guiding disease.MethodsThe cIL-18BP gene was isolated from the genome of fowlpox vaccine virus by PCR through a pair of special primers and cloned into vectors pPICZαA,then expressed in yeast GS115.The biologic activity of recombinant proteins binding with cIL-18 was measured,inhibiting the activity of cIL-18 enhancing relative cells secreting IFN-γ was confirmed through ELISA.ResultsThe cIL-18BP gene was cloned from fowlpox virus and acquired high performance expression in yeast systems induced with methanol identified by SDS-PAGE.Recombinant cIL-18BP purified can bind specifically with recombinant cIL-18 determined by ELISA test.cIL-18BP can antagonise the activity of cIL-18 with determining the IFN-γ concentration secreting in PBMCs and MSB1 cells stimulated by cIL-18 respectively.Conclusion The experiment indicates that recombinant cIL-18BP can inhibit the activity of cIL-18 stimulating related immune cells secreting IFN-γ.Deletion of the cIL-18BP from virus may improve the safety and immunogenicity of fowlpox virus vaccine.
